INTERNATIONAL ATOMIC ENERGY AGENCY (IAEA) SAEEGUARDS IMPLE-ENTATION AT RANCHO SECO As you are awam, the U. S. is committed by Treaty to permit the IAEA to apply safeguards in the U. S. in the sane manner as in non-nuclear weapon countries.
10 CFR 75.8 specifies that a Facility Attachment (FA) will be developed, and the FA will be implemented at the nuclear facility thmugh a license condition. The following presents the status of the above subject for Rancho Seco at this tine.
The FA, pmviously developed for Rancho Seco, is not yet finalized. A copy of the latest U. S. appmved version is enclosed, but additional minor changes might be made by the IAEA. We don't know what the changes will be, but we will not issue a license condition to implement the FA until it is finalized and discussed with you.
Regarding the license condition, we sent you an August 10, 1981 letter that contained 6 " draft stanmary evaluation" for your~ comment. The draft sumary evaluation was our first attempt to define appropriate license conditions. We reviewed your coments to our sumary evalua;1on, and our reply to your comments was hand delivered to Mr. Columbo when Mr. Padovan visited the plant site on November 4,1981. Mr. Coltzbo later told us that SMUD had no additional comments.
Having considered your coments, a draft of pmposed license conditions j
has been developed by us, and a copy is enclosed for your review and p'fOF coment. We are looking fon<ard to having your input on this atter.
